How much do digital marketing jobs pay per year?

As of Aug 18, 2026, the average yearly pay for digital marketing in Rochester, NY is $86,589.00,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$67,600.00 and $98,700.00 per year,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is digital marketing?

Digital marketing refers to the use of digital channels, such as websites, social media, email, search engines, and mobile apps, to promote products or services. It involves strategies like content marketing, search engine optimization (SEO), pay-per-click advertising, and social media marketing to reach and engage target audiences online. Digital marketing allows businesses to measure results in real-time, target specific demographics, and optimize campaigns for better performance. It is essential for organizations looking to grow their presence and compete in today’s digital-first marketplace.

What are the qualifications to get a job in digital marketing?

The qualifications and skills that you need to start a career in digital marketing depend on the duties and responsibilities of your position. Employers at digital marketing agencies may seek a degree in marketing or advertising. Writers, graphic designers, and web design professionals should earn a degree in their area of specialization. You can also pursue a postsecondary certificate from a community college. There are professional certifications as well, such as the Digital Marketing Certification from the American Marketing Association. You should maintain a portfolio of work to show employers.

What is the difference between Digital Marketing vs Content Marketing?

AspectDigital MarketingContent Marketing
FocusBroad online promotion strategies including SEO, PPC, email, social mediaCreating and distributing valuable content to attract and engage audiences
SkillsSEO, SEM, analytics, social media managementContent creation, storytelling, copywriting
Work EnvironmentDigital agencies, marketing departments, freelanceContent teams, marketing agencies, in-house marketing
CertificationsGoogle Ads, HubSpot, Facebook BlueprintContent marketing certifications, HubSpot, Content Marketing Institute

Digital Marketing encompasses a wide range of online promotional tactics, while Content Marketing specifically focuses on creating valuable content to attract and retain audiences. Both roles often overlap but serve different strategic purposes within digital campaigns.

Job description

 As the driving force behind CEIPAL’s Digital Marketing efforts, you will play strategize & execute campaigns into shaping us to be :

●      The Next Generation, Artificial Intelligence enabled Talent Acquisition Software platform, rapidly disrupting the recruitment software market

●      The Industry’s top rated, Applicant Tracking System, CRM, and Workforce Management Software

As Digital Marketing Manager you will report to the company’s Chief Marketing Officer and will be at the forefront of CEIPAL’s efforts to disrupt the HR management software market. You will drive the digital marketing strategy and execution with ultimate responsibility for the new business generated by Marketing. You will own the online demand generation budget and be responsible for efficiently deploying it to grow demand and new business, with support from our digital marketing agency and demand gen team. You will research and analyze competitor’s campaigns and obtain insights from customers and industry partners to create a high-impact online demand generation strategy, utilizing the full range of online marketing channels. You will manage the complete marketing conversion funnel and be responsible for tracking, reporting, and optimizing conversions.

Responsibilities:

●      Build and articulate a coherent digital marketing strategy, including budget, channels, and success metrics

●      Oversee and manage the company’s digital marketing efforts

●      Drive execution of the digital marketing strategy, including budget, channels, and reporting

●      Research, discover, test, and optimize new online marketing channels and campaigns

●      Build targeted demand generation campaigns focusing on multiple markets, industries, company sizes, and geographic regions

●      Continuously benchmark the CEIPAL demand generation efforts against competitors and industry best practices, and be at the forefront of modern B2B demand generation

Required Qualifications:

●       5+ years of online marketing demand generation experience

●       An understanding of (and passion for) conversion rate optimization strategies and how to use them to achieve the best ROI

●       An aptitude for seeing the “big picture” and determining the right mix of demand generation strategies

●       Expert understanding of the various digital marketing channels, including SEO, PPC, Paid Social, Email, re-marketing, and software review sites such as Capterra, Software Advice, etc.

●       A solid understanding of technical, on-, and off-page SEO strategies

●       Proven success with developing and implementing demand generation and conversion optimization strategies for the various stages of the Marketing Funnel

●       Expertise managing Hubspot, including report generation, workflows, forms, and conversion tracking

●       Expertise in configuring and using Google Analytics to analyze online behavior, define, and optimize lead conversion paths

●       Team player who excels at cross-group collaboration and problem solving

●       A passion for data, analysis, and statistics

●       Master’s degree in mathematics, statistics, or computer science
